I use this as a starter, often at the start of a revision lesson at the end of a topic . Students work in pairs. Give each pair a copy of the blank grid – I normally do this on A3. Show them the completed grid for 1 minute. In silence and with no writing they have to try to remember as much of the vocab as they can. Take the grid off the board. In pairs they have 1 minute to fill in as much as they can. If necessary you can then show them the grid again in silence and with no writing. Go through the answers – pairs can swap their sheets for marking. Then show the coloured grid and give them 1 minute to find as many links as they can – e.g. the green background is for future time phrases and underlined are verbs in the present tense.
